Output 332076308af0bfd1425e425560438062c035c582e23f3ee6e00427ee226ce994:0

value
69142268013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45462651300180e94a641927f417f9188a3ccf22 OP_EQUALVERIFY OP_CHECKSIG
address
DBTPCaaMfCdoNYC33XCxuLfHoQxPFtsVZg
transaction
332076308af0bfd1425e425560438062c035c582e23f3ee6e00427ee226ce994